벡터 데이터베이스 종류별 성능 차이 직접 써본 후기

벡터 데이터베이스 종류별 성능 차이를 직접 경험해보고 싶어 여러 서비스를 사용해봤어요. 각기 다른 특성과 속도, 정확도에 대해 기대가 컸지만, 실제로는 어떤 환경에서 강점을 보일지 미리 예측하기 어려웠던 점도 있었죠. 이번 사용기를 통해 생각보다 큰 차이가 있진 않았지만, 몇몇 제품에서는 분명한 장단점이 있다는 점을 확인할 수 있었어요.

벡터 데이터베이스 종류별 성능 차이 직접 써본 후기

벡터 데이터베이스를 처음 접하게 된 계기와 느낌

딥러닝과 자연어처리 기술의 발전으로 벡터 기반 검색에 관심이 생기면서 해당 기술을 직접 써보게 되었어요. 다양한 벡터 데이터베이스가 있다는 사실을 알게 되어 성능 차이에 대한 기대와 함께 과연 실제 업무에 적합할지에 대한 걱정도 있었답니다. 특히 데이터 처리 속도와 정확도 면에서 큰 차이가 있을까 궁금했는데, 처음 사용해본 결과 직관적인 인터페이스와 빠른 응답 속도가 인상적이었어요. 이 경험을 통해 각 제품별 특징을 좀 더 자세히 살펴보고 싶다는 생각이 들었습니다.

처음 만난 벡터 데이터 처리 환경은 기대 이상으로 신선한 느낌이었어요.

효율적인 선택을 위한 만족 포인트와 비교 기준

벡터 데이터베이스별 성능 평가 시, 반응 속도와 정확도, 확장성, 그리고 사용 편의성을 주로 고려했어요. 이번 사용에서는 특히 검색 속도와 대용량 처리 능력이 만족스러웠고, 관리 도구가 직관적이라는 점도 큰 장점으로 느꼈답니다. 하지만 일부는 인프라 요구 사항이 높아 선택 시 주의가 필요했어요.

항목 비교 기준 장점 단점
검색 속도 응답 시간(ms) 빠른 결과 반환 초기 학습 필요
확장성 데이터 처리량 대용량 데이터 효율적 자원 요구량 높음
사용 편의성 관리 인터페이스 직관적 UI 제공 복잡한 설정 단계

이번 사용에서 확인한 만족 포인트들은 실제로 벡터 데이터베이스 선택 시 중요한 기준이 되어 여러 옵션 중 최적의 서비스를 고르는 데 도움이 되었어요.

속도와 확장성, 그리고 편의성의 균형이 좋은 선택의 핵심입니다.

실제 경험에서 얻은 벡터 저장소 활용법

다양한 제품을 직접 사용하면서 느낀 점은 각각의 플랫폼이 특정 상황에 더 적합하다는 것입니다. 어떤 서비스는 대규모 데이터 처리에 강점이 있지만, 반대로 실시간 검색 속도나 정확도가 중요한 환경에서는 다른 쪽이 더 나은 결과를 보여줬어요. 또한, 인프라 구성이나 비용 효율성 측면에서도 차이가 크기 때문에 목적에 맞춰 신중하게 선택하는 게 중요하다는 걸 알게 됐습니다. 실제 후기를 통해 배운 점은 단순 성능 수치 외에도 사용자 편의성이나 확장성도 꼭 고려해야 한다는 사실입니다.

다양한 벡터 저장소는 상황에 따라 각기 다른 장점을 발휘한다는 점을 꼭 기억하세요.

성능 한계와 대응 전략

다양한 벡터 저장소를 사용하며 가장 불편했던 점은 대용량 데이터 처리 시 응답 속도가 크게 저하되는 현상이었어요. 특히 일부 서비스는 검색 정확도와 속도 간 균형 조절이 어려워 원하는 결과를 얻기 힘들었죠. 이를 해결하기 위해 인덱스 구조를 변경하거나 하드웨어 자원을 추가하는 방식을 적용했는데, 실제 후기에서는 이 방법으로 성능이 개선되는 것을 확인할 수 있었습니다. 또한, 여러 데이터베이스를 병행 사용해 각각의 강점을 살리는 전략도 도움이 됐어요.

최적화 작업과 병행 사용이 성능 문제를 극복하는 데 중요한 역할을 했습니다.

어떤 사용자에게 적합한지 살펴보기

벡터 데이터베이스는 각각 특유의 장단점이 있어 목적과 환경에 따라 최적의 선택이 달라질 수 있어요. 대용량 실시간 검색이 필요한 경우에는 빠른 응답 속도와 확장성을 중시하는 솔루션이 유리하고, 정밀한 유사도 계산이 중요한 프로젝트라면 정확도가 뛰어난 제품이 더 적합하답니다. 반면, 초기 도입 비용이나 사용 편의성을 우선시하는 분들께는 복잡한 설정이나 높은 유지관리 비용이 아쉬울 수 있어요.

목적에 맞는 성능과 기능을 꼼꼼히 따져보는 것이 성공적인 선택의 핵심이에요.

직접 써보고 내린 최종 판단

벡터 데이터베이스 종류별 성능 차이를 고려할 때, 대규모 검색과 빠른 응답이 필요한 프로젝트에는 Faiss와 Milvus를 추천해요. 반면 복잡한 쿼리와 다양한 기능을 원하면 Pinecone이 적합합니다. 소규모나 실험적인 용도에는 간단한 오픈소스가 좋고, 재사용 의향은 목적과 환경에 따라 달라질 수 있으니 신중한 선택이 필요해요.

후기 보고 많이 물어보는 질문

Q. 벡터 DB 종류 차이 쉽게 알려줘?

A. 종류마다 검색 속도와 확장성에 차이가 있어요. 용도에 맞게 선택하는 게 좋아요.

Q. 비용 대비 성능 좋은 벡터 DB는?

A. 오픈소스는 비용 절감에 유리하고, 클라우드는 관리 편리성이 뛰어나요.

Q. 벡터 DB 사용 시 주의할 점은?

A. 데이터 크기와 업데이트 빈도에 따라 성능 저하가 올 수 있으니 주의했어요.

Q. 어떤 상황에 벡터 DB 선택하면 좋을까?

A. 대규모 유사도 검색이나 추천 시스템 구축할 때 특히 효과적이었어요.

댓글 남기기